Transaction 84380d059e748bcf760b463b98521b10ea34190aeb853b11003a576d0e05e329

3 Input
2 Outputs
  • 84380d059e748bcf760b463b98521b10ea34190aeb853b11003a576d0e05e329:0
  • value  2720972
    address  3BN8vyEtz6P5Xzf8wQGGi4PygLHfAq1wWN
  • 84380d059e748bcf760b463b98521b10ea34190aeb853b11003a576d0e05e329:1
  • value  396884
    address  3L2VHMQ1Zch9tLtdyGNSWbEPGDuGDCzZmd